Acetylene gas (C2H2) is used in welding torches. When it reacts with oxygen, it produces carbon dioxide (CO2) and steam (H2O). The reaction can be described by the equation:
2C2H2 + 5O2 ➔ 4CO2 + 2H2O. How much mass of C2H2 is needed to react with 68.1 g of O2 to produce 75.0 g of CO2 and 15.35 g of steam?
